Two Strike['s] band [Brulé Lakota] Pine Ridge 1891
Content Provider | Library of Congress - Photographs |
---|---|
Spatial Coverage | South Dakota--Pine Ridge |
Description | Photograph shows a group of Sioux men, full-length, standing, facing front, in a half-circle behind a group of five Sioux sitting on the ground, three wrapped in blankets and with their backs to the viewer. |
